Output b5529608a2e648040a94f0a906dfffc2a5f7b9f8dd0a726bda1286fc4b23b216:0

value
9000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850babe385ffff52705c9fc26ca60608f7a7f095 OP_EQUAL
address
3DpVn18gjKXbrLTczkpzUt8FATPdpUY2mJ
transaction
b5529608a2e648040a94f0a906dfffc2a5f7b9f8dd0a726bda1286fc4b23b216
confirmations
394254
spent
true